Nearly 1 in 3 US Pharmacies Have Closed Since 2010, Widening Access Gaps

A study has found that about 29% of the nearly 90 000 retail pharmacies in the US operating between 2010 and 2021 have closed, and they were more likely to shut down if they were in predominantly Black and Latino neighborhoods than in White neighborhoods, in urban vs rural neighborhoods, or were independent pharmacies rather than chains.
